In Balsam Grove, SC, homeowners typically pay between $300 and $6,000 for emergency roof repair. The final cost depends heavily on the severity of the damage, the roofing material, and the complexity of the repair.

Job complexity
Simple repairs cost less than full installations or replacements. Multi-step jobs requiring permits or inspections add to the total.
Material quality
Budget, mid-grade, and premium materials can swing the price significantly. Discuss options with your contractor to find the right balance.
Local labor rates
Labor costs vary by region, season, and demand. Urban areas and peak seasons typically have higher rates than rural or off-peak times.
Site conditions
Difficult access, older structures, code upgrades, or unexpected issues discovered during work can increase the final cost.

Emergency roof repairs typically involve urgent situations such as sudden leaks during heavy rain, missing or broken tiles from high winds, water pouring through ceilings, falling debris or ridge tiles, significant storm damage, cracked or split flat roof membranes, and any structural concerns or signs of sagging that pose an immediate risk.
Estimating an emergency roof repair involves assessing the extent and severity of the damage, identifying the type of roofing material, considering the accessibility of the affected area, and factoring in the urgency of the repair. It's crucial to include labor, materials, and any potential cleanup costs like tree damage removal.
The 25% Rule suggests that if more than 25% of a roof's surface requires repairs, it's often more economical and strategic to consider a full roof replacement rather than performing multiple patchwork repairs. This guideline helps homeowners and contractors determine the most cost-effective long-term solution.
Key factors that increase emergency roof repair costs include extensive structural damage, the need for specialized materials, difficult roof accessibility, repairs required outside of standard business hours, and circumstances demanding immediate response, such as major storm damage or a significant tree falling on the roof.
While an immediate temporary repair (like tarping or patching) is often necessary to prevent further damage, permanent repairs can sometimes be scheduled once the immediate crisis has passed and a thorough assessment can be conducted. For more extensive damage, a comprehensive repair plan might be more cost-effective than rushed permanent solutions without proper planning.
